Frequently asked questions
What is the lug width of the Breitling Superocean A17378211B1S1?
The Breitling Superocean A17378211B1S1 has a lug width of 24mm. This generous measurement is proportional to the 46mm case diameter. To verify it, use a digital calliper to measure the internal distance between the two lugs at their narrowest point.
What is the best strap for the Breitling Superocean A17378211B1S1?
For water use, a vulcanised rubber strap in 24mm is the most functional choice. For urban or formal settings, an alligator or vegetable-tanned calf leather strap develops a distinguished patina that complements the ceramic bezel. A ballistic nylon NATO strap is ideal for everyday robustness and versatility.
How do you change the strap on the Breitling Superocean A17378211B1S1?
Use a spring bar tool to release the strap. Insert the forked tip between the lug and the strap end, compress the spring bar and slide the strap free. Take care not to scratch the ceramic bezel during the operation. Casati Milano also offers an in-atelier strap change service by appointment.

How long does a leather strap last on a Breitling Superocean A17378211B1S1?
Longevity depends on the material and conditions of use. A high-quality alligator or vegetable-tanned calf strap, kept away from water and treated regularly with leather conditioner, will last between two and five years. Frequent exposure to salt water or chlorine significantly accelerates deterioration; for diving use, a rubber or NATO strap is strongly recommended.
